After a prolonged slump, the meme coin market is finally showing signs of life. In the past 24 hours, major meme coins have posted notable gains, lifting the total market capitalization back above $36 billion.
Major Meme Coins Stage Collective Rally
Veteran coins Dogecoin (DOGE) and Shiba Inu (SHIB) rose 5% and 4% respectively, demonstrating resilience. DogWifHat (WIF) outperformed with a 14% jump. However, the standout performer was Popcat (POPCAT), which skyrocketed over 29% in the same period.
Market analysts attribute the rebound largely to Bitcoin (BTC), which recovered 5% from its recent low. As the flagship cryptocurrency gains ground, it tends to reignite overall market interest, pulling meme coins along with it.
It remains too early to declare a full recovery, but the uptick offers welcome relief to investors who have endured weeks of bearish pressure.
